- Purification
- Recombinant human TET2 (1197-end) was expressed by baculovirus in Sf9 insect cells using an N-Terminal Glutathione-S-Transferase fusion protein. The purity was determined to be >75% by densitometry.

- Application Notes
-
Application Note: TET2 Protein is stored in 50 mM Tris-HCl, pH 7.5, 50 mM NaCl, 10 mM glutathione, 0.1 mM EDTA, 0.25 mM DTT, 0.1 mM PMSF, 25 % glycerol. TET2 Protein is suitable for use in Western Blot. Expect a band approximately ~124 kDa on specific lysates or tissues. Specific conditions for reactivity should be optimized by the end user.
